How to Choose Your Perfect 2025 Hair Color
With so many stunning options, how do you choose? Consider your skin tone, lifestyle, and maintenance level. Cool tones generally suit cool complexions, while warm tones flatter golden undertones. Always consult with a professional colorist to achieve these looks safely.
Maintaining Your 2025 Hair Color
Vibrant colors require special care. Invest in color-safe shampoo, weekly treatments, and heat protection. For pastels and neons, use cool water when washing and limit sun exposure. Many salons now offer color-refreshing glosses between appointments.
